The Marion County Sheriff's Office is seeking Sahar Abdulaziz Algeri, who is wanted on an active warrant for interference with child custody. Algeri is accused of taking her three children, aged 4 to 8, who have been separated from their father, the legal custodian, for more than a year.
Authorities suspect Algeri and the children may be located in the Richardson, Texas area. Algeri, who was in the United States on a visa from Saudi Arabia, is reportedly evading contact with law enforcement and the children's father. The Sheriff's Office emphasizes its primary concern is the safety and well-being of the children.
Investigators noted that Algeri allegedly fled with the children after learning her husband intended to file for divorce. An individual with whom Algeri allegedly had an affair is believed to reside in Richardson, Texas. The Sheriff's Office urges anyone with information to contact them immediately.
